BMRB Entry 30652

Title:
Human CstF-64 RRM
Deposition date:
2019-08-08
Original release date:
2020-08-03
Authors:
Latham, M.; Masoumzadeh, E.
Citation:

Citation: Grozdanov, Petar; Masoumzadeh, Elahe; Kalscheuer, Vera; Bienvenu, Thierry; Billuart, Pierre; Delrue, Marie-Ange; Latham, Michael; MacDonald, Clinton. "A missense mutation in the CSTF2 gene that impairs the function of the RNA recognition motif and causes defects in 3' end processing is associated with intellectual disability in humans"  Nucleic Acids Res. 48, 9804-9821 (2020).
PubMed: 32816001

Assembly members:

Assembly members:
entity_1, polymer, 108 residues, 11965.345 Da.

Natural source:

Natural source:   Common Name: Human   Taxonomy ID: 9606   Superkingdom: Eukaryota   Kingdom: Metazoa   Genus/species: Homo sapiens

Experimental source:

Experimental source:   Production method: recombinant technology   Host organism: Escherichia coli   Vector: pET22

Data sets:
Data typeCount
13C chemical shifts241
15N chemical shifts102
1H chemical shifts101
